Runbook: account recovery — Gildstage seat-map renderer. If the renderer's admin account locks after failed deploy auth, don't reset via the box office portal; it desyncs seat holds. Use the Gildstage recovery console instead. Reviewer note: console access is gated on the standing recovery passphrase, which appears directly below.

unlock words, yawig-kagef: gordor-holvan-ulaael-pramir-ulaiel-tamdor

# Break-Glass: Catalog Cache Invalidation

Scope: the Pinrow product catalog at Veldstone Retail. If stale prices persist after a purge and the Hollowmere invalidation queue is wedged, use break-glass to flush the edge tier directly. Contractors: get verbal sign-off from the catalog lead first. Steps: open the Hollowmere admin shell, select emergency-flush, confirm the tenant, and run it once — repeated flushes thrash the origin. Access is logged and expires after 20 minutes. Unseal the admin shell with the passphrase below.

recovery phrase for kahop-tajog: istix-casvan

Building Access — Spare Hardware Storage (Room 0.14)

Reception staff only. Room 0.14, ground floor, past the mail sort area, holds spare keyboards, monitors, cables, and loaner laptops. Do not lend loaner laptops without a signed chit. Log every item removed in the blue binder on the shelf inside the door. Returns go on the right-hand rack, tagged. Door auto-locks; never prop it. Lost-key reports go to the Harlowe Facilities queue, not email. To open the keypad lock, enter the code below.

turnstile pass: bdg-FVNQRS-72965873